Al-Amoudi Refuses to Hand Over Money for His Freedom

Saudi releases most detainees in a corruption probe. Al-Amoudi does not yet agree to settlements. Authorities react by arresting his relatives. BY ENGIDU WOLDIE | ESAT NEWS Reports coming out of Saudi Arabia say Ethiopian born Saudi billionaire has refused to hand over his money in return for his release. The billionaire and 200 other businessmen […]

Continue Reading